How was the method of making pottery by using coils of clay better than simply shaping the clay by hand?

Answer:

The answer to this question is that the Coil Method, allows the potter to create pots of various sizes, and various shapes that are sturdier than those that are created by the simple hand method. These rolls, or coils, which are the bases of the technique, are what gives these bases and ceramic artwork their particular shapes and make them sturdier than those created with the simple hand, or tool, technique.

Explanation:

Although the Coil Method is just another of the different styles of pottery creation, research shows that it is a technique used by potters mostly because it allows them to control clay easily and it permits the creation of shapes that would not be possible with other techniques. This research also shows that the coil technique allows potters to add height to their ceramics in ways that other techniques do not, and finally, it is a technique that can be easily combined with others to create really magnificent pieces.
